Air India staff assaulted
Staff Reporter
NEW DELHI: Passengers of a Mumbai-bound Air India flight allegedly roughed up three members of the airline staff at the Indira Gandhi International Airport here on Sunday night. They were apparently upset over a delay in the departure of their flight.
Flight AI-307, coming from Tokyo with a stopover at Delhi, had to be grounded because of a technical snag. Around 90 passengers were to take the flight at 8 p.m. When it got delayed, some angry passengers beat up three members of the Air India staff. “The staff members received minor injuries,” said airline spokesperson Jitendra Bhargava.
The passengers were later sent to Mumbai by a special plane, he added.
